# Pinwheel Components — shared library versioning env.
# Controls which channel (stable/canary) the registry resolver pins.
# Set PINWHEEL_CHANNEL and PINWHEEL_LOCKFILE_PATH above the fold.
# On-call: if version resolution fails at 03:00 builds, check channel drift first.
# Publishing to the internal registry requires an auth credential; it sits on the line directly below.

vault entry, yahif-yajep: COURIER_KEY29=b802bdf8034096b65a51c6ba5abe2

For the board's consideration: Marwick Analytics proposes growing total headcount by eleven percent next year, weighted toward the Fennbrook engineering hub and the new Solvane integration team. Hiring in administrative functions stays flat, with attrition absorbed through internal moves. The plan assumes stable contract renewals with our two anchor clients and modest expansion in the Hallere region. Contingency scenarios are modelled in the appendix. The underlying strategic assumptions appear in the confidential note below.

internal memo for hahif-hahaf: Headcount on the Zorwyn team goes from 9 to 100 by the end of October. Gross margin on Zorwyn came in at 5 percent against a plan of 10 percent.

Ticket QP-3318: Planner in Corvate DB 7.4 picks a full scan on filtered joins. Repro: load the sample set, run the nightly suite twice, compare plan hashes — second run regresses. Affects the Hallowmere staging tier only. To pull traces from the diagnostics endpoint, authenticate with the following token.

portal login ticket: eyJhbGciOiJIUzI1NiIsInR5cCI6IkpXVCJ9.eyJzdWIiOiI0Z4ywpUMsBIn0.ca5FVhkdBXa3

Original go-live was June; integration testing against the Penhale ledger system surfaced data-mapping defects, pushing delivery to October. The vendor, Quillard Systems, has committed additional engineers at no extra cost. Budget variance stands at four percent, within tolerance. Weekly checkpoints continue under Mรs. Aldene's oversight. Dependencies on the payroll migration are documented separately. The confidential note below describes the broader planning context.

internal memo for yahag-tahog: The pricing group signed off on a budget of $152.8 million for Project Soriel.